Kenya: USAID Launches $6m Program for Climate Resilience Efforts in Kenya

allAfrica.com Tuesday, 7 May 2024 ()
[VOA] Nairobi, Kenya -- The United States Agency for International Development last week launched a $6 million program to support small businesses and financial institutions in northern Kenya that are looking to implement climate-smart practices and enhance their resilience to climate-related challenges. The region suffers from recurring droughts; when it does rain, it often floods and causes people to lose their livelihoods.
